Telomeres: The Key to Cellular Health
Telomeres are tiny protective caps found at the ends of our chromosomes. These structures are vital for maintaining the stability of our genetic code. Every time a cell divides, telomeres shorten slightly. Over time, this shortening can lead to cellular dysfunction and impaired repair mechanisms, contributing to the aging process. However, factors such as chronic stress can accelerate this shortening, causing the body to age biologically faster than expected.
The Role of Stress in Telomere Shortening
Research indicates that chronic stress can significantly speed up the shortening of telomeres. This rapid shortening can lead to accelerated cellular aging, making the body more susceptible to age-related diseases and health issues. The good news is that adopting healthier daily habits can help maintain the length and integrity of telomeres, promoting cellular health and longevity.
Biological Aging vs. Chronological Aging
Biological aging, driven by telomere shortening and other cellular processes, can differ significantly from chronological aging. While chronological aging is simply the passage of time, biological aging reflects the actual condition of our cells and tissues. Stress can cause a person to age biologically faster than their chronological age, leading to various health issues. Understanding this distinction is crucial for taking proactive measures to maintain overall health and well-being.
Practical Tips for Maintaining Telomere Health
Stress Management Techniques
-
Mindfulness and Meditation: Practices like mindfulness and meditation can help reduce stress levels, promoting a healthier state of mind and body. Regular meditation sessions can help manage stress and maintain telomere health.
-
Physical Activity: Regular exercise is a powerful tool for managing stress and promoting overall health. Activities such as yoga, running, or even a brisk walk can help reduce stress hormones and improve telomere integrity.
Healthy Lifestyle Choices
-
Balanced Diet: A diet rich in antioxidants, vitamins, and minerals can support cellular health and help maintain telomere length. Foods like berries, leafy greens, and nuts are excellent choices for a telomere-friendly diet.
-
Adequate Sleep: Quality sleep is essential for the body to repair and rejuvenate itself. Ensure you get 7-9 hours of uninterrupted sleep each night to support cellular function and telomere health.
